The case.
The science already turned once. During COVID, wastewater surveillance proved that sanitation carries early public-health signal: cities read infection curves from sewers days before clinics saw them. That evidence sits at city scale, one step removed from where people actually are.
The bathrooms communities share, public toilets, planes, stadiums, schools and care settings, are the places that signal passes through first. Detection technology able to work at room and building scale is emerging, and nobody has yet joined it up.
The movement already exists. Advocates for better public bathrooms, the open bathroom movement, have been making the access and dignity case for years. An early-warning layer gives that case a public-health engine: the same room that serves people better can also protect them sooner.
The campaign researches how those pieces connect: the technology, the operators of shared bathrooms, the advocates, and the public-health systems that would act on the signal.
How ready is the system?
We score every campaign with a System Readiness Level diagnostic, in the tradition of NASA’s Technology Readiness Levels but aimed at a whole system rather than a single product. Six levers are scored against nine levels; the weakest lever sets the system’s level, and the weakest lever is the next work.
Levels 1–3 live on the ground; 4–6 in the connective layer; 7–9 in the wider system.
The system sits at SRL 1, bound by orchestration and capital, not by technology. The research is further ahead than intuition suggests; the convening has not begun. That gap is the campaign.
Scores follow the weakest-lever rule: each lever is rated at the highest level whose conditions are fully met, with evidence, and the lowest rating sets the system’s level.
